Output e63fa2130e54a9aee7012d012793e9b78add89185353854fba5c14dbaa9eb942:12

value
1497576
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4d74c1584693e963331faa9354ac7bf7f6e3c7d5 OP_EQUALVERIFY OP_CHECKSIG
address
184Yu4xGqK4SCxUHQKeP7XE1m7Dxoksxro
transaction
e63fa2130e54a9aee7012d012793e9b78add89185353854fba5c14dbaa9eb942